Output 729c386d4a361fd06059cb8e20c24452eaf964eee95c155b0c0f9e241fc75224:5

value
143578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deac44432585a03d66fc2982c61868b5a366e5d4 OP_EQUAL
address
3MzQJRhrk5JAGYeuSzwESQqW5RLw7XLEt6
transaction
729c386d4a361fd06059cb8e20c24452eaf964eee95c155b0c0f9e241fc75224
confirmations
259906
spent
true